The Art of Biblical Narrative
- Written by: Robert Alter
- Narrated by: Andy Ingalls
- Length: 10 hrs and 24 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all0
-
Performance0
-
Story0
Renowned critic and translator Robert Alter’s The Art of Biblical Narrative has radically expanded our view of the Bible by recasting it as a work of literary art deserving studied criticism. In this seminal work, Alter describes how the Hebrew Bible’s many authors used innovative literary styles and devices such as parallelism, contrastive dialogue, and narrative tempo to tell one of the most revolutionary stories of all time: the revelation of a single God. In so doing, Alter shows, these writers reshaped not only history, but also the art of storytelling itself.

The Kingdom of God Is Within You
- Written by: Leo Tolstoy
- Narrated by: Graham Dunlop
- Length: 12 hrs and 36 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all0
-
Performance0
-
Story0
The Kingdom of God Is Within You is Leo Tolstoy’s groundbreaking work on faith, morality, and the futility of violence. Written in 1894, this powerful book was banned in his native Russia, yet it became one of the most influential manifestos of nonviolent resistance in the modern world. Tolstoy argues that true Christianity is not found in the rituals of church or the authority of the state, but in the living example of Christ’s teachings—especially the command to resist evil not with force, but with love and forgiveness.
